Now, that gives me ideas. The situation I have in mind is, that someone wants to propose such a more physical relationship to someone.
While Klingon directness and the principle
<<pe'vIl yIjatlh!>>
... are intriguing me to assume, that saying
<<manga'chuq! Ha'!>> or <<HIngagh!>>
would be appropriate in a few situations, could he/she instead ask (e.g., in... uhm... less upheated situations)
<<parmaqqaywI' SoHqang'a'?>>
I reread TKD section 6.3., but could not conclude, how natural it feels to put ALL KIND of suffixes on pronouns.
Besides grammatical advice - for a Klingon, would this maybe sound a little cheesy?
